rouvrir

To reopen.


Here, 'rouvrir' metaphorically denotes embarking back into a previously closed topic or conversation, illustrating its usage beyond physical places.

Après le débat, ils ont rouvert la discussion pour clarifier certains points.

After the debate, they reopened the discussion to clarify certain points.


In this case, 'rouvrir' refers to reopening or launching a digital application, showcasing modern usage of the term in the context of technology.

L'application a rouvert toute seule après un redémarrage imprévu.

The application reopened by itself after an unexpected restart.


In this sentence, 'rouvrir' is used in its primary meaning, which is to 'reopen' something that was previously closed, indicating a physical venue or place.

Ils ont décidé de rouvrir le musée après les rénovations.

They decided to reopen the museum after the renovations.
